CITY College is the International Faculty of the University of Sheffield and is located in Thessaloniki, Greece. Bridging the UK with the South East and Eastern Europe, CITY College offers to students the unique opportunity to study for a top class British degree of the University of Sheffield in their region. CITY College was founded in 1989 in Thessaloniki. Through its 20-year operation it has been established as one of the best educational institutions across South East Europe. In 2009 CITY College started its operation as the International Faculty of the University of Sheffield. It is the 6th faculty of the British University and the only one located overseas. The University of Sheffield is not simply cooperating with CITY College since it is an integral part of the University. Sustainable Harvest is a green specialty coffee importer with a unique mission to link small holder growers to better paying markets using a concept it created called “Relationship Coffee.” As one of the largest fair trade coffee importers in the world, the price Sustainable Harvest pays growers is always well above the world commodity prices for coffee. Sustainable Harvest hopes to set an example for how a small business can create sustainable systems that build lasting markets for coffee farmers around the globe. Relationship Coffee is built upon a foundation of transparency, full traceability, trade credit, total quality, and training. Sustainable Harvest invests about half of what it earns as a coffee importer to train small-holder coffee growers and coffee cooperatives to improve their quality and access higher paying markets. It does this through five overseas farmer-training offices in Africa, South America, Central America and Mexico – all of which are devoted to farmer training and coffee support services. As one of the fastest growing specialty coffee importers, the company sources from the top organic and fair trade farms from around the world. The company sells these coffees to USA, Canadian and Japanese coffee roasters and retailers, and helps them tell the story behind the beans. Sustainable Harvest was the first importer to focus exclusively on organic, shade-grown, and fair trade specialty coffees. Question by asdfghjkl: If I pursue a nursing degree in college, will I ever be able to study abroad?
So I definitely want to major in nursing in college. I’ve wanted to be a nurse my whole life. But, one of the most exciting things about college is getting to study abroad. I’m worried that if I pursue a nursing degree, that I’ll never get to study abroad! So is it true? I just need some advice on this situation. Thank you
Best answer:
Answer by Amber Marie You can study abroad with Nursing, but you will want an exchange program that is partnered with your school, and you will have to do it in an English speaking country (if English is your only language), unless you are also minoring in that language. If you go to a country where English is not the official language they will not teach anything besides that language to you, you wouldn’t be able to take nursing courses. The study away director at your school will be able to help you.
